Keep Your Summary Brief

How To Make a Customer Service Resume | Microsoft Word

Prioritize elements that are most relevant to the position you’re applying for to help keep your resume summary concise. It’s better to include a smaller amount of your notable qualifications rather than a long list of less significant details. This ensures that a hiring manager can read your summary quickly to get a better understanding of your most important skills, knowledge and experiences.

    Quantify Your Professional Experience

    When detailing your professional experience, back up your accomplishments by using numbers whenever possible to clearly convey what work youve handled in the past.

    If you neglect to quantify your experience, hiring managers wont be able to tell if youre a good fit or if you can handle the workload necessary for the job.

    For example, our applicant takes care to include numbers when possible:

    • Handle 50+ customer interactions per day, giving detailed, personalized, friendly, and polite service to ensure customer retention and satisfaction
    • Collate source data such as customer names, addresses, phone numbers, credit card information for over 1000 customers and enter data into customer service software
    • Trained 4 new employees in customer service script recitation, conflict resolution, and data entry practices
    • Developed expert knowledge of food and drink pairings, memorizing over 200 types of cocktails, wines and spirits
    • Improved use of upselling techniques to increase sales by an average of $10 per ticket

    Even if the stats you provide arent the most impressive, your future employer will be grateful that you gave a truthful representation of your abilities and experience, making them more likely to call you in for an interview.

    Resume Summary Example: The Winning Formula

    For many people, a customer service representative position is one of the best entry-level opportunities. With all that competition, your resume summary should be a short but engaging story. For many recruiters and HR professionals, your summary may be the most important part of your resume. If your basic qualifications are in place, the summary is what makes you stand out. Its your first introduction, and its often your only chance to be creative on your resume.

    Your customer service representative resume summary should be a description of yourself with a premium on interpersonal skills, but with a dash of technological aptitude. As for personal qualities, two are king: dependability and empathy. Customer service is time-sensitive, so its important to show youll be there when needed. Empathy ensures you connect with the clients on a human level.

    According to AE research, 68% of customers consider a polite representative to be the key to great customer service. This shows that soft skills and social impressions define the quality of your work. This is what your employer is likely to emphasize.

    In closing, what the employer and recruiter want to see in your resume summary is an image of a customer service representative wholl make clients happy. A person who will promote trust in the brand and provide positive experiences. A person who will always reliably be there to take a customer request.

    Accounting For The Ats

    The battle with the ATS starts at the very first section of your resume. Applicant Tracking Systemsare based on keyword analysis. They automatically review and score resumes based on keywords that are important to the employer. Customer service resumes that don’t make the cut are filtered out and never reach a recruiter. This means you can greatly increases your chances of passing the ATS test by using the correct keywords. To do so, analyze the job listing, which should have the necessary keywords already in it.

    If you find the job description to be confusing, too wordy or complicated, there are additional tools you can use to analyze it. Word clouds are a great way to understand which ideas and qualities are the most important to an employer. Services like Wordle or Worditout.com will help you make sense of listings that arent written in a clear way. Word clouds will also show you hidden patterns if there are any. This may become your secret weapon against automated ATS filtering.

    Write A Resume Objective Targeting The Position

    A customer service resume objective should show hiring managers that youre qualified and motivated. When writing your objective, remember to explain why your experience, skills, and prior achievements will benefit the company and help it grow.

    If you have a lot of experience, a resume summary might be better for you. Knowing how to start your resume is an important job-hunting skill.

    A successful customer service resume objective is normally three sentences.

    Heres an example of a good resume objective for a CSR position:

    Customer Service Representative with 5+ years experience working in call centers, performing functions from sales and tech support to customer care. Familiar with major customer service software like Salesforce and HubSpot, excellent at conflict resolution, and possess a positive attitude. Aiming to use my proven customer service skills and experience to effectively fill the managerial role at .

    Emphasize Your Retail And Sales Skills

    Successful retail sales associates are valued not because of their educational background or work history, but because they have a well-developed set of sales skills.

    When putting together an application for a retail sales job, be sure to include a detailed skills section on your resume that targets the exact abilities the employer is looking for.

    If youre unsure what kind of skills you should highlight, start by reading the job ad for the position you want to fill and take note of the abilities listed in the Requirements section of the advertisement. Then, include as many of these skills on your resume as possible.

    Heres an example of a highly detailed resume skills section featuring highly marketable sales associate skills:

    • Customer Service: Able to gauge and meet the needs of the customer
    • Product knowledge: SUp to date on the latest trends in the retail industry, and able to educate the customers about your brand
    • Sales: Ability to increase sales by upselling customers using the information gathered while assisting them
    • Merchandising: Possess a deep understanding of the best merchandising practices and inventory management
    • Basic Math Skills: Able to calculate the total price after factoring in sales, discounts, and promotions
    • Language Ability: Bilingual in Spanish or Chinese
